This episode we talk to musician Benjamin Drury. Ben is a composer and producer who also plays bass in the band Helena Pop. Ben is a seasoned performer and composer who has composed works for multiple festivals, including the Canberra International Music festival and You Are Here.
We talk about Ben’s body of work and some of the different approaches to composition that Ben has taken. Ben tells us about creating music for different settings and the process of discovering the nuances that exist between musician, space and audience. Ben also gives us a very in-depth looking into the world of machine learn and music creation. We also talk about installation work and site specific works, and delivering a new experience to audiences away from regular venues.
